Bathroom Wave Shelving 

Wave Shelving is a shelving unit for the bathroom designed by Tim Wigmore from New Zealand. This design is sleek and minimalist providing a beautiful experience. Here are a few words about Tim Wigmore design philosophy :

My aim is to enthuse and involve people with engaging objects that elicit mental and physical interaction. My work strives to connect people with design and to produce objects that develop strong rewarding relationships and provide value and enjoyment. I strive to make high quality work that resists obsolescence, and use materials and process that reflect my deep respect for the health of my clients, myself, and our surroundings. – Via Comtemporist
